    Abstract: A die cast part of a die casting mold having at least one first component comprising a pressure zone, at least one second component and at least one heat exchange chamber permeated by a fluid and formed by the components for controlling the temperature of the pressure zone. The first component comprises a heat transfer surface integral to at least one wall of the heat exchange chamber and thermally associated with the pressure zone, and the pressure zone bounds at least one region of the gate region. The second component comprises at least one fluid guiding protrusion protruding into the heat transfer chamber and/or a fluid guiding recess open toward the first component. The fluid guiding recess forms at least one portion of the heat exchange chamber and/or the fluid guiding protrusion and/or the fluid guiding recess forms a flow contour surface of the second component in particular adapted to the curve of the heat transfer surface.

    Abstract: A temperature control device (14) for a diecasting device (1), having a first component (16), a second component (17), and at least one fluid channel (29) implemented in the first component (16) and/or the second component (17), the first component (16) and/or the second component (17) comprise at least one receptacle (18) for a region (27) of the diecasting device (1) on which a casting material can act, in particular a casting inlet (21), and the fluid channel (29) opens into at least one heat exchange chamber (15) present as an open-edged recess (23) at least in regions of the first component (16) and lockable with the second component (17). The invention further relates to a diecasting device (1).

    Abstract: A die casting tool (1) of a die casting machine, includes a first mold (2) having a first and a second mold part (5, 6), which can be displaced in a linear manner to each other for closing and opening the mold and which form at least one casting chamber between each other, and including at least one casting runner (16), further includes an additional, second mold (3) having a third and a fourth mold part (7, 8), which can be displaced in a linear manner to each other in a parallel manner to the mold parts (5, 6) of the first mold (2) for closing and opening the mold, and which form at least one further casting chamber between each other, wherein a mold part (5, 6) of the first mold (2) and a mold part (7, 8) of the second mold (3) are disposed back-to-back and receive between each other an intermediate element (4), which is the casting runner (16).

    Abstract: A process for heat-treating and coating a component, comprising the following steps: solution-annealing of the component and subsequent coating of the component which is heated to a temperature which is so high that it is thereby possible to carry out both heat treatment in order to set the material properties of the solution-annealed component and also the coating. An AlSi10MgMn aluminum alloy is preferably used. The solution-annealing takes place at 400-500° C. over the course of 5-120 minutes, and the age-hardening and coating take place at 150-300° C. over the course of 30-60 minutes. The coating may be carried out as cathodic or anodic dip painting.
